NEW POSITION
The Department of Sociology at the University of California, Santa
Barbara invites applications for a position in social demography
(broadly construed) at the rank of Assistant Professor. We seek a
scholar who could help build a strong sociological presence in UCSB?s
new interdisciplinary Broom Center for Demography and increase the
Department?s teaching capacity in quantitative methodology. The ideal
candidate will have an active research agenda, a strong commitment to
quality teaching, and a substantive research agenda that complement
one or more of the Department?s core areas of strength. The following
demographic phenomena are of particular interest: national and
transnational migrant flows; racial, ethnic, gender, and economic
inequalities; trends in sexual behavior, marriage and family
structures; trends and inequalities in crime and punishment; trends
and inequalities in health and psychological well being; divisions of
labor within households and workplaces; and processes of national and
transnational diffusion (e.g., of cultural beliefs and identity
categories, social and consumption practices, organizational forms,
laws and regulations, collective action and movements).

We are especially interested in candidates who can contribute to the
diversity and excellence of the academic community through research,
teaching, and service. Applications received before October 15, 2011
will receive full consideration, although the position will remain
open until filled. Applicants should submit a letter of interest,
curriculum vitae, samples of recent publications and syllabi, and a
list of references to: Department of Sociology, University of
California, Santa Barbara, CA 93106-9430. The University of California
is an Equal Opportunity/Affirmative Action Employer.
